Burhanpur Air Ambulance Arrives Too Late; Patient Dies
Jyoti Jitendra Kshirsagar was very sick because of a heart valve problem.
Doctors wanted to take her from Burhanpur to a hospital in Indore.
An air ambulance was arranged to move her more quickly.
The aircraft was supposed to arrive on Friday, but bad weather stopped it from taking off.
It tried again on Saturday.
The aircraft reached Burhanpur around noon.
Sadly, Jyoti died shortly before it arrived.
Officials had arranged the transfer equipment and medical help.
Her family appreciated the effort but was grieving her death.
